WINONA, Minn. — The Saint Mary’s University Volunteer Mentors are encouraging individuals, organizations, and churches in Winona to submit requests for the annual Lasallian Day of Service event on Saturday, Oct. 27.

Lasallian Day of Service was started by Saint Mary’s University as a day for students and alumni to volunteer in their communities — in the spirit of the Lasallian mission of service to others. Volunteers will be available from 9 a.m. to noon on Oct. 27, to help with fall cleaning, raking leaves, painting, or other chores. Saint Mary’s will supply the workers, if you supply the materials needed (paint, brushes, rakes, tools, etc.).

Requests must be made by Wednesday, Oct. 24, to Kirsten Rotz the Office of Campus Ministry at Saint Mary’s at krotz@smumn.edu or 507-457-7329. In your email request, please include description of work, address of location, and estimated time it will take to complete with three students.

Besides Winona, Saint Mary’s alumni will also be volunteering in the Twin Cities, Chicago, and New York City as part of Lasallian Day of Service.
